Output 63d073b4dd0a818d4f286c8142349735802f86f88a79a440b494d99995da2530:21

value
4362
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bb50cbfc384f100018bcf408e3d2c17e27f1297c9dd8067ad6745048b36e4935
address
bc1phdgvhlpcfugqqx9u7syw85kp0cnlz2tunhvqv7kkw3gy3vmwfy6st4p280
transaction
63d073b4dd0a818d4f286c8142349735802f86f88a79a440b494d99995da2530
spent
true